Billions for Anji
Five 10-billion-yuan (US$1.54 billion) programs were initiated in Zhejiang Province鈥檚 Anji County last month, aiming to modernize the county, which is currently most known for its bamboo.
The programs will concentrate on the construction of a pumped storage power station, the extension of a bullet train railway, the establishment of a town for start-ups, and for overall improvements of local infrastructure.
The under-construction power station is expected to have one of the largest installed capacities in the world.
The railway will connect the county with Henan and Anhui provinces once it is finished in about five years.
The town will include new infrastructure like parks and boulevards that add more green to the place. A storage center is expected to make 10 billion yuan annually.
